30115 Removal of nose polyp(s)
Also known as: nasal polyp removal extensive, polypectomy extensive, large polyp removal
Endoscopic or transnasal removal of nasal polyp or polyps using extensive debridement and removal of significantly infiltrated or recurrent tissue.
In Plain Language
large nose bump removal; extensive nasal growth removal
Clinical Context
Indicated for large, recurrent, or significantly infiltrated nasal polyps; often involves debridement and sinus disease management.

Billing & Documentation
As a surgical CPT code, proper documentation must include the operative report detailing the procedure performed, patient positioning, approach, findings, and any complications. This code has a 90-day global period, which includes the day of the procedure, 1 day preoperative, and 90 days of postoperative care. Ensure the diagnosis code (ICD-10) supports medical necessity for the procedure.
